Decide which type of swap is best for you. The most common option is the swapping of primary residences, in which case both parties are vacationing at the exact same time in each others' houses. If you own more than one dwelling, you can participate in swaps that are nonsimultaneous so you can travel at a different time than the man with whom you are swapping. With this kind of swap, you may well be able to change timeshares and vacation rentals. Another sort of nonsimultaneous exchange could involve inviting a man to stay in your home while you're there, and vice versa.
A Short Term Apartment Rentals in Jaunter NSW agreement should contain the address of the property being leased, the dates and times the renter will have access to the property, age, and maximum occupancy rules, payment policies, check out procedures, cancellation policies and the rules related to the property, such as rules regarding pets, smoking, and pool or utility use. If the property is located in a place where storms or hurricanes may happen, a clause may be added if there is a mandatory evacuation that allows for cancellations or refunds.

Determine whether you want to list your vacation property through a property management company or if you need to record it yourself. A third party is an excellent choice for those who don't need to manage paperwork, the tenant screenings, and transaction. Bear in mind that a management firm can also be hired to take care of problems and maintenance that may appear with renters. This is particularly useful if you do not live close enough to the property to handle problems promptly or should you not possess time to rectify a tenant's trouble on short notice.

The contract should also contain a cancellation policy that may deter a renter from backing out of the trade. The contract should include a good faith clause which will release the renter from the contract if a catastrophe happens before the rental and renders the property uninhabitable if the property is in a place prone to natural disasters including hurricanes, floods or earthquakes.
Have all conditions for the vacation home rental in writing. The contract needs to say the place of the property, dates of total rental cost, leasing and rent payment schedule. Any individual policies such as policies relating to smoking, pets, and occupancy limitations also should be in the contract. Include a damages clause, which defines deposit rules and monetary repercussions affecting any damages.
